Today (09/09/2015) the government of the Bolivarian Republic of Venezuela, through its foreign affair office, has published a very interesting article named «The truth about the Venezuela-Colombia border situation», in the very famous american newspaper The New York Times.
But, unlike what some employees of the Venezuelan government have appointed, this article is not a work of research of any of the famous newspaper journalists, no, it is actually a paid advertisement, that (with a full-page extension) might have costed at least U$104.000 (Source: Billfold), money equivalent to 14.000 full monthly minimum wages in that South American country.
